Form 1099 is an Internal Revenue Service (IRS) form that taxpayers use to report specific types of payments. There is an entire series of these informational returns identified by letter, ranging from 1099-A through 1099-SA. Social security taxes officially went up on January 1st as the withholding rate returned to 6.2% for employees. This is the end to the previous tax holiday in effect for the past two years. Read More
